To provide a detailed overview of the nutritional value of a sandwich, we should first specify the components typically found in a sandwich. A basic sandwich usually consists of bread, a protein source (like deli meat, cheese, or plant-based alternatives), vegetables (such as lettuce, tomatoes, and cucumbers), and condiments (like mayonnaise, mustard, or hummus).

Nutritional Components

  1. Bread

    • Nutrients: Carbohydrates, fiber, B-vitamins, iron (especially whole grain bread).
    • Health Benefits: Provides energy, supports digestive health, and contributes to daily nutrient intake.
  2. Protein Source

    • Nutrients: Protein, iron, zinc, B-vitamins (found in meats), and possibly healthy fats (in cheese or legumes).
    • Health Benefits: Essential for muscle repair, immune function, and overall growth and development.
  3. Vegetables

    • Nutrients: Vitamins A and C, potassium, folate, antioxidants, dietary fiber.
    • Health Benefits: Support immune health, reduce the risk of chronic diseases, and promote digestive health.
  4. Condiments

    • Nutrients: May contain fats (like in mayonnaise), sugars, or additional vitamins and minerals (like in hummus).
    • Health Benefits: Can enhance flavor and improve satisfaction, but should be consumed in moderation.

Example of a Balanced Sandwich

Whole Grain Turkey and Avocado Sandwich:

  • Ingredients: Whole grain bread, sliced turkey, avocado, spinach, tomatoes, mustard.

Nutritional Value (Approximate per serving):

  • Calories: 350-450
  • Protein: 25-30g
  • Carbohydrates: 35-45g
  • Fiber: 8-12g
  • Fats: 10-15g (mostly healthy fats from avocado)
  • Vitamins and Minerals: Rich in vitamins A and C, potassium, magnesium, iron.

Health Benefits of This Sandwich

  1. Balanced Macros: The combination of protein, healthy fats, and complex carbohydrates promotes sustained energy.
  2. Nutrient Dense: The variety of ingredients enhances the micronutrient profile, making it beneficial for overall health.
  3. Heart Health: Whole grain bread and avocado can contribute to heart health by providing fiber, healthy fats, and essential nutrients.
  4. Weight Management: High fiber content promotes fullness, which can help with appetite control.
